STARTED IN the year 2010 by a Harvard graduate Amuleek Singh Bijral, Chai Point is on its expansion spree and plans to open 30 new stores by March 2018. Spread across eight cities with over 100 stores in total, Chai Point is running on an Omni Channel business strategy- Stores, Chai on call, boxC.in and launch of loose leaf tea (LLT).

“By 2018, we estimate the business to grow by 90 – 100 per cent over 2017 in revenue terms. Making a strong foray into Chennai, our focus markets for the year would be NCRY and Mumbai as we would continue to add new stores after establishing ourselves strongly in Bangalore,” said Bijral in a conversation with BW Hotelier.

In the year 2016, Chai Point launched boxC.in, a first of its kind IoT enabled tea/coffee-dispensing machine aimed at the corporate clients. “Currently, we have more than 2,000 active installations of boxC.in and it contributes 40 per cent to the overall revenues of the company. We expect boxC.in to grow at 100 per cent for the next five years,” Bijral told us.

boxC.in is currently annually growing at the rate of 125 per cent and is expected to keep this momentum for the next three years. In addition to this, the delivery model is also growing at 250 per cent  y-o-y as informed by Bijral.

Bijral feels that having the largest corporate workforces in the world, people in India are not able to enjoy an authentic cup of their favourite beverage while at work. According to him the launch of boxC.in has bridged that gap. “This year, in October, we launched an Android version of boxC.in with advanced IoT capabilities, which ensured remote trouble shooting, more beverage options among many other new features,” he added.

The Chai retailing segment is witnessing an exciting phase and the investors too are watching this space keenly and putting their money where the mouth is. Large corporates have also announced their plan to foray into this segment. “We are planning to raise Series C round of funding to strengthen our brand across various Omni channel platforms,” Bijral informed.
